Market Ecosystem and Operational Framework Product Categories and Stakeholders Product Types: The market primarily comprises Q-switched Nd:YAG lasers, Alexandrite lasers, and diode-pumped solid-state lasers, with Nd:YAG dominating due to its versatility in medical and industrial sectors. Stakeholders: Key players include laser system manufacturers, component suppliers (lasers, optics, electronics), distributors, healthcare providers, industrial end-users, and regulatory bodies. Demand-Supply Framework and Market Operations Demand is driven by end-user needs for high-precision, reliable, and cost-effective laser systems. Supply chains involve sourcing raw materials such as laser-grade crystals, optical components, and electronic modules from global suppliers, followed by manufacturing in South Korea’s advanced facilities. Distribution channels include direct sales to OEMs, third-party distributors, and online platforms, with end-users spanning clinics, hospitals, manufacturing plants, and research institutions. Value Chain and Revenue Models Raw Material Sourcing: Suppliers of laser crystals, optical components, and electronic modules, often from China, Japan, and Europe. Manufacturing: Involves precision assembly, calibration, and quality assurance, primarily conducted by local and multinational firms with R&D centers in South Korea. Distribution and Delivery: Direct OEM sales, regional distributors, and online channels facilitate market penetration. Lifecycle Services: Include system calibration, maintenance, upgrades, and training, generating recurring revenue streams. Adoption Trends and Use Cases Across End-User Segments Medical Aesthetics Laser tattoo removal, pigmented lesion treatment, and skin rejuvenation constitute the largest demand drivers. Clinics increasingly adopt compact, user-friendly systems. For example, South Korea’s leading dermatology clinics report a 12% annual growth in laser-based cosmetic procedures. Industrial Manufacturing Precision laser systems are integral to electronics, automotive, and jewelry manufacturing. The trend toward miniaturization and high-speed processing fuels demand for high-energy, fast-pulse lasers. Scientific Research and Education Research institutions utilize Q-switched lasers for material analysis, spectroscopy, and quantum optics, fostering innovation and technological breakthroughs.
